According to the NEC, conductors “subject to physical damage” must be #6 AWG or larger. It’s easy to debate whether the wire grounding your solar panels is subject to physical damage because they’re on your roof and under solar panels. But if your building department inspector requires #6 ...

WebThis is a minimum procedure in an area where the ground is moist (electrically conductive). Where the ground may be dry, especially sandy, or where lightning may be particularly severe, more rods should be installed, at least 10 feet apart. Connect or “bond” all ground rods together via bare copper wire (#6 or larger, see the NEC) and bury ...

WebPV System Equipment Ground NEC 690.45(A) requires that equipment grounding conductors for PV source and output circuits be sized in accordance with NEC table 250.122, which allows for a smaller gauge ground wire, such as a # 10 or #12 AWG, to be used in this portion of the PV system.
